34/*
35 * This header implements a wrapper over mmap (mmap_align) that memory
36 * maps a file region that is not necessarily multiple of the page size.
37 * It returns a structure (instead of a pointer) that contains the mmap
38 * pointer (page-aligned) and a pointer to the offset requested within
39 * that page. Note: in the current implementation, the "addr" parameter
40 * cannot be forced, so we allocate at an address chosen by the OS.
41 */
42
43struct mmap_align {
44 void *page_aligned_addr; /* mmap address, aligned to floor */
45 size_t page_aligned_length; /* mmap length, containing range */
46
47 void *addr; /* virtual mmap address */
48 size_t length; /* virtual mmap length */
49};

51#ifdef __WIN32__
52#include <windows.h>
53
54/*
55 * On windows the memory mapping offset must be aligned to the memory
56 * allocator allocation granularity and not the page size.
57 */
58static inline
59off_t get_page_aligned_offset(off_t offset, size_t page_size)
60{
61 SYSTEM_INFO sysinfo;
62
63 GetNativeSystemInfo(&sysinfo);
64
65 return ALIGN_FLOOR(offset, sysinfo.dwAllocationGranularity);
66}
67#else
68static inline
69off_t get_page_aligned_offset(off_t offset, size_t page_size)
70{
71 return ALIGN_FLOOR(offset, page_size);
72}
73#endif
